教务管理.系统需求分析介绍说明

教务管理.系统需求分析介绍说明

ID:25457667

大小:386.50 KB

页数:13页

时间:2018-11-20

教务管理.系统需求分析介绍说明_第1页
教务管理.系统需求分析介绍说明_第2页
教务管理.系统需求分析介绍说明_第3页
教务管理.系统需求分析介绍说明_第4页
教务管理.系统需求分析介绍说明_第5页
资源描述:

《教务管理.系统需求分析介绍说明》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、-信息系统工程与实践《教务管理系统》需求说明书专业班级:计本1201班项目分组:计本1201班第二组姓名学号1:戴明昊1205170107姓名学号2:杨新芬1205170130姓名学号3:万丽涛1205170102编写人:万丽涛1205170102-1序11.1编写目的11.2背景11.3定义11.4参考资料12任务概述22.1运行环境与资源22.2功能22.3用户特征22.4限制与约束23功能行为需求33.1引言33.2业务需求功能模型——用例模型33.3相关用例的展开——活动图73.4对象类模型93.5输出结果94性能需求104.1数据精确度104.2时间特性104.3适应性

2、104.4故障处理105运行需求115.1用户界面115.2硬件界面115.3软件界面116其他要求11-软件需求说明书1序1.1编写目的编写本报告的目的是解决整个项目系统的“做什么”的问题,对于开发技术并没有涉及,而主要是通过建立模型的方式来描述用户的需求,为客户、用户、开发方等不同参与方提供一个交流的渠道。本报告预期的读者是设计人员、开发人员、项目管理人员、测试人员和用户。1.2背景教务管理教务管理系统面向教务处、院、系教师和全校学生,实现学籍管理、课表管理、成绩管理、教学质量监控等功能。1.3定义SQL(StructuredQueryLanguage)结构化查询语言。SQL

3、语言的主要功能就是同各种数据库建立联系,进行沟通。PHP开发平台。1.4参考资料(1)钱乐秋等,《软件工程》,清华大学出版社;(2)张害藩,《软件工程导论》(第四版),清华大学出版社;(3)王珊等,《数据库原理及设计》,清华大学出版社;(4)赵池龙等,《软件工程实践教程》,电子工业出版社。-2任务概述2.1运行环境与资源运行环境:Windows 数据库:MYSQL 硬件条件:服务器sun工作站,终端为pc机2.2功能开发教务管理系统旨在改变原有人工进行教务管理的工作方式,实现学籍管理、课表管理、成绩管理、教学质量监控等功能。下图是教务管理系统功能模块图:图1教务管理系统功能模块图

4、2.3用户特征本软件最终用户特点是对教师和学生资料统筹管理及登陆查询。操作人员为本校学生及老师,对其专业技术要求并不高,只要熟悉基本的电脑知识。维护人员为本校管理员,要求达到计算机专业水平。2.4限制与约束a.系统的运行寿命的最小值:2年 b.进行系统方案选择比较的时间:1周c.经费来源:**公司-d.运行环境:Windowse.数据库:MYSQL f.硬件条件:服务器sun工作站,终端为pc机g.系统投入使用的最晚时间:2个月3功能行为需求3.1引言开发教务管理系统旨在改变原有人工进行教务管理的工作方式,使教务人员及操作者通过计算机方便的进行教务管理,随时添加、查询、修改,使工

5、作人员从繁琐的填表、查表工作中解放出来,使供需双方都获得满意的结果;促进报表、统计数字的规范化,提高工作效率,降低教务管理维护费用,提高行政工作效率,改善服务质量,为学校领导决策提供支持。该系统面向教务处、院、系教师和全校学生,实现学籍管理、课表管理、成绩管理、教学质量监控等功能。3.2业务需求功能模型——用例模型教务管理系统分为管理员模块、教师模块和学生模块,实现录入课表、录入成绩、查询课表、查询成绩、进行教学质量评价等功能,为更形象的表现各功能间的关系,建立以下用例模型:(1)管理员管理用例图图2管理员管理用例图-用例规约是测试用例应当遵守的规则。管理员操作中,有管理员登录、

6、管理员录入教师和学生信息、管理员查询成绩、管理员查询教学质量评价、管理员修改成绩、管理员录入课表等用例,以下为详细的用例规约:表1管理员登陆用例规约用例名称:管理员登录用例ID:admin1角色:管理员用例说明:用例主要功能是实现管理员登录前置条件:启动程序,进入登录界面基本事件流:参与者动作系统响应1、用户输入基本信息(用户名和密码),点击“管理员”按钮2、系统查找数据库,看该用户是否在数据库中,若存在,进入主页面;若不存在,进入2.1.1;若输入错误,进入2.2.1其他事件流:无异常事件流:参与者动作系统响应2.1.1未输入用户名2.1.2未输入密码2.2.1输入密码错误2.

7、2.2用户名不存在2.1.1提示用户名或密码不能为空2.2.1提示用户名或密码不正确后置条件:登录成功表2录入课表用例规约用例名称:录入课表用例ID:admin1角色:管理员用例说明:用例主要功能是实现课表的录入,用例起始于管理员点击“录入课表”按钮前置条件:进入主界面基本事件流:参与者动作系统响应1、进入主界面,管理员点击“录入课表”按钮3、管理员录入课表相关信息,点击“确定”按钮2、系统响应录入课表按钮,进入录入界面4、判断管理员是否输入信息,若输入,返回主界面;若未输入,进

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。